Danis, Devils top Isles, 2-1

NEWARK, N.J. - Yann Danis made 23 saves and stopped four in-close attempts in the third period against his former Islanders teammates, helping the New Jersey Devils beat New York, 2-1, last night for their fourth straight win. Full Article at Philadelphia Inquirer
